English IPA • All Grain • 2 gal

All Grain Pale Ale

My first all grain. Volume is small because I don't have the equipment to do a 5 gal all grain batch....

Ingredients (All Grain2 gal)

  • 3.5 lbs English 2-row Pale

    English 2-row Pale

    All English Ales. Workhorse of British Brewing. Infusion Mash.

  • 0.5 lbs Crystal Malt 40°L

    Crystal Malt 40°L

    Sweet, mild caramel flavor and a golden color. Use in light lagers and light ales.

  • 0.5 oz Cascade - 9.4 AA% whole; boiled 60 min

    Cascade

    Spicy with citrus notes. Slightly grapefruity.

  • 0.25 oz Cascade - 9.4 AA% whole; boiled 20 min

    Cascade

    Spicy with citrus notes. Slightly grapefruity.

  • 0.25 oz Cascade - 9.4 AA% whole; boiled 2 min

    Cascade

    Spicy with citrus notes. Slightly grapefruity.

  • Wyeast 1968 London ESB Ale™

    Wyeast 1968 London ESB Ale™

    Highly flocculant top-fermenting strain with rich, malty character and balanced fruitiness. This strain is so flocculant that additional aeration and agitation is needed. An excellent strain for cask-conditioned ales.

Style (BJCP)

Category: 14 - India Pale Ale (IPA)

Subcategory: A - English IPA

Range for this Style
Original Gravity: 1.051 1.050 - 1.075
Terminal Gravity: 1.011 1.010 - 1.018
Color: 12.3 SRM 8 - 14
Alcohol: 5.2% ABV 5% - 7.5%
Bitterness: 62.9 IBU 40 - 60
